The Veins of Life: Networked Roots and Fungal Allies

Beneath our feet lies a hidden labyrinth of interconnected roots, forming an intricate network that serves as the "internet of plants." These roots establish an underground communication network, allowing flora to share vital information, nutrients, and even warn each other of impending threats. This hidden web of relationship between plants and their fungal allies, known as mycorrhizal networks, enables the exchange of nutrients, water, and chemical signals, fostering a true sense of unity among botanical beings.

The Secret Language of Plants: Chemical Conversations

While our vocal cords allow us to express thoughts and feelings through words, plants have developed an eloquent chemical language that surpasses our comprehension. These silent conversations are carried out through the release of pheromones and volatile organic compounds, which convey vital information to other plants and organisms in their vicinity.

For example, when an herbivore begins munching on a leaf, the wounded plant releases chemical signals that warn neighboring plants of the imminent danger. In response, nearby vegetation adapts their chemical composition, making them less appetizing to the herbivores. With these chemical conversations, the plant people can protect themselves and their community from potential harm.

Seeds of Survival: Clever Strategies and Adaptation

The plant people have mastered ingenious techniques to ensure their survival in various environments. From the intelligence of seed dispersal mechanisms to the intricate strategies of mimicking other organisms, plants demonstrate unparalleled adaptability.

Take, for instance, the orchid. This exceptional flower species possesses deceptive adaptations, fooling unsuspecting insects into pollinating them. By resembling the appearance, scent, and even pheromones of female insects, orchids manipulate male insects into aiding their reproduction. Such cunning strategies have enabled plants to thrive in the harshest of environments, adapting to every challenge thrown their way.

Beyond Earthly Abilities: The Extraordinary World of Plant Sensitivity

Plants may lack a nervous system, but that doesn't mean they are insensitive to the world around them. From the mesmerizing movements of the sensitive plant to the ethereal night-time sensitivity of flowers like the evening primrose, plant people exhibit an enigmatic responsiveness to external stimuli.

Additionally, numerous studies have shown that plants can perceive and respond to sound vibrations, including music. These findings suggest that the plant kingdom can experience sensory responses beyond our current comprehension.
